Data were collected from approximately 200 different colleges and universities in the United States for the year 2012. The goal was to predict enrollment. The study revealed the following:
Coefficient T Score
Intercept 13409.000 2.309
Tuition -3.457 -3.288
Library (number of books in thousand) -0.427 -0.628
Salary (average salary of Full Professors at the school) 0.731 2.711
SAT (average score for entering freshmen) -17.043 -2.431
Sports (0,1 dummy variable, 1 if school has division 1 program) 4983.843 4.137
Faculty (Number of full time faculty on staff) 7.199 9.019
R2 = 0.7110
F = 61.10
Fully Evaluate and Interpret these empirical results on the basis of all available statistics (use a 0.05 significance level).

enrollment = b0 + b1*Tution + b2 * Library + b3 * Salary_Prof + b4*SAT_score + b5*Sports + b6* Faculty
any coefficient is regression is interpreted as when other variable remains constant ,by change in 1 unit of independent variable . , there will be change of beta coefficent in dependent variable
here b0 = 13409 when everything else is 0 , then enrollment will be 13409
b1 = -3.457 , if tution is increased by 1 unit , enrollemnt will decrease by 3.457 unit
similarly other
b5 = 4983.843 , if means if it has division 1 program , then there will be 4983.843 more enrollement on average than that in without sports program,
now t-critical for 0.05 significance level is nearly 2 or -2
hence when t-score is more than 2 or less than -2 , the independent variable is significant
here every variable is significant except Library as -2 < -0.628 <2
R^2 = 0.7110
it means that this model explains 71.1 % of total variationa
F = 61.10 which is very high , it means , the given model is significant at 0.05 significance level.
